The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MoFA) and the Abu Dhabi Music & Arts Foundation (ADMAF) have reaffirmed their commitment to cultural diplomacy by signing a renewed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) today. 
 
Her Excellency Noura Al Kaabi, Minister of State at the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, and Her Excellency Huda Al Khamis-Kanoo, Founder of ADMAF and Artistic Director of the Abu Dhabi Festival, signed the agreement, reflecting theirshared dedication to enhancing the UAE’s global cultural presence.
 
The memorandum reaffirms the partnership between both entities in advancing the UAE’s leadership in arts and culture and builds upon the initial agreement signed in March 2018.
 
Her Excellency Al Kaabi said: "The UAE is committed to promoting dialogue, friendship, and cooperation with nations worldwide while showcasing our nation‘s rich heritage, values, and artistic achievements through joint initiatives.

This renewed commitment for collaborationbetween MoFA and ADMAF supports the UAE’s leadership in promoting the values of openness and peace, and building bridges of international cooperation and cultural exchange, reinforcingthe UAE’s rich heritage and contemporary artistic contributions.”
 
Her Excellency Al Khamis-Kanoo added: “Under the honorary founding patronage of His Highness Sheikh Abdullah B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Deputy Prime Minister and Minister of Foreign Affairs, and Founding Honorary Patron of Abu Dhabi Festival, we continue our sustainable cultural journey and thank the ongoing efforts of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and its diplomatic missions for supporting our programs abroad.”
 
Her Excellency continued: “Guided by the vision of our wise leadership, we contribute to enabling cultural diplomacy, strengthening the UAE’s global presence, and upholding the values of diversity and understanding through our strategic partnerships, which today total 37 partners from major institutions and festivals worldwide.
